Chapter 34 New Household Registration
"There are floods in the south and droughts here. Life is hard for both of us."
Someone sighed, "You have to get through it, even if it's tough. What are you going to do, run away from the famine? The world is in such chaos these days, where can you possibly escape to?"
Zhao Yan's thoughts wavered slightly, and her mood became heavy.
Is there a flood in the south?
Is the world really about to descend into chaos?
Does that mean she needs to earn more money quickly?
The living conditions here are already bad, so if things really get chaotic, she won't panic if she has money in her hands.
However, if there really is a natural disaster, the government will try to appease the people, right?
unless……
Zhao Yan thought of the history she had read before.
Unless the government is inactive and officials exploit the people.
Add to that natural disasters, and people can't get enough to eat and can't survive, so they choose to flee the famine, resulting in a large number of refugees.
When migrants move from one place to another, if the government does not intervene, large-scale chaos will break out under the threat of hunger, commonly known as a migrant riot.
Historically, almost all peasant uprisings have been created by accumulating buffs in this way.
Zhao Yan didn't dare to think too much about it and quickly pushed the cart away from the tea stall.
The Great Qing Kingdom, where she now resides, has been established for 235 years.
Judging from the lifespan of dynasties in history, the Great Qing Kingdom's fortunes seem to be nearing their end, and it could collapse at any moment.
With disasters raging in various places, if the time truly comes to flee the famine, Zhao Yan has to make some preparations in advance.
However, her top priority now is to make as much money as possible.
Pushing her cart through the shops, Zhao Yan bought what she needed an hour later.
A small iron pot, a kitchen knife, a wood-chopping knife, and some pots and pans.
She didn't buy any food.
There was food on the shelves, so she wasn't worried at all that she and her daughter would go hungry.
After putting everything into the storage cabinet in a secluded corner, Zhao Yan left with a basket on her back and a cart.
There were many things to do today. After having lunch at Tian Xiu'e's place and putting her daughter to sleep, Zhao Yan took a bag of brown sugar and two pounds of pork belly to the village head's house.
"You want to hire someone to fix your house?"
Chen Youjin ushered the man into the courtyard, and the old Taoist priest's eyes were fixed on the woman before him.
So this is what Sanlang's wife is like after she regained consciousness; she does know how to handle people.
Zhao Yan took out a tael of silver from her sleeve and handed it over along with the two gifts she had brought.
"Yes, please ask Uncle Muramasa to help me find a few honest and reliable people to repair my roof. It would be best if it could be fixed by tomorrow."
"This one or two taels is for wages. I hope Uncle Village Chief can help me out. The rest is for me to treat Uncle Village Chief to drinks."
Then, she took out five taels of silver and said, "I don't know the ins and outs of ordering these tiles, so I'd appreciate it if Uncle Village Chief could help me."
Chen Youjin stroked his chin and thought for a moment, then accepted the gifts and money without hesitation.
"No problem, I'll go find someone later. Once the tiles are ordered, we can start work tomorrow."
The fact that she can produce money so quickly after breaking off the engagement shows that Sanlang's wife is quite something.
Zhao Yan knew that her actions would make the village head look at her differently, but she would have many more opportunities to interact with him in the future, so she didn't intend to hide anything.
Remembering something else, she couldn't help but ask, "Uncle Village Chief, after I sever ties with the Yang family, can I register as a female household?"
She wasn't very familiar with the laws of the Great Qing Kingdom, but the village head must have.
Sure enough, Chen Youjin asked in surprise, "You want to register as a female household?"
Realizing his tone was inappropriate, he quickly adjusted his mindset and softened his tone, "Given your current situation, you can indeed apply for a female household registration, but..."
"Uncle Muramasa, but what?"
Are there any other additional conditions?
Zhao Yan's mood sank for a moment.
"However, there is also a registration fee to pay, which is not cheap."
Chen Youjin glanced at Zhao Yan and said, "It costs ten taels of silver to register a female household registration."
Ten taels of silver could support a family of several people for two years in a stable life.
The transfer fee is too high, and poor women generally don't even dare to think about becoming female owners.
The government was actually not very willing to allow women to register their own households.
As women, their duty is to be good wives and mothers.
Zhao Yan has already spent seven taels of silver to repair the house. Now that she's a female household member... will she still have any money left?
Chen Youjin didn't quite believe it.
She had just left the Yang family's house; where would she get the money?
Unexpectedly, after considering it for a moment, Zhao Yan asked, "Just the account opening fee? No other requirements?"
"No."
"Then I'll have to trouble Uncle Muramasa for help again."
Zhao Yan took out another ten taels of silver from her sleeve and handed it to Chen Youjin.
Only by registering as a female household can she and Xiaomi have their own household registration, making it convenient for them to go anywhere in the future.
Chen Youjin stared in astonishment at the ten taels of silver in front of him, wondering to himself: How much wealth does this Zhao Yan still have? Where did she get the money? Does that scoundrel Yang Zhangshi even know?
Judging from Yang Zhangshi's reaction this morning, she must not know about this.
It should be noted that the Yang family's wealth is all controlled by Madam Yang Zhang. If she knew that Zhao Yan was hiding silver, she certainly wouldn't remain unmoved.
But before that, Zhao Yan was not only strong and capable of doing chores, she was also mentally challenged.
She couldn't possibly be hiding money.
Thinking of this, Chen Youjin's gaze towards Zhao Yan immediately became dark and inscrutable.
Zhao Yan, once she regained consciousness, was quite capable, accumulating so much silver in such a short time. It was a pity that Yang Zhangshi severed ties with her.
He silently accepted the silver and put it in his pocket.
"Since you have this money, shall we go to the county government office now to register your household?"
Zhao Yan's eyes lit up instantly. "Okay."
Chen Youjin's family owned a cow. He called his eldest son, Chen Hu, to drive the oxcart and take Zhao Yan with him to Baima Town.
Upon arriving at the county government office, accompanied by Chen Youjin, Zhao Yan's household registration was quickly processed, and Yang Xiaomi's surname was changed from Yang to Zhao.
Now, her name is Zhao Xiaomi.
Holding the thin new household registration booklet, Zhao Yan couldn't help but smile contentedly.
Great.
Now they are truly no longer related to the Yang family.
“The household registration is done, so let’s go take a look at the roof tiles now?” Chen Youjin suggested.
The sun was still high in the sky when he traveled by oxcart, and he didn't find it tiring at all.
Zhao Yan was eager to get the roof fixed as soon as possible, and politely replied, "Okay."
The three of them hurriedly went to look at the tiles again, determined the quantity needed, and agreed to deliver them first thing the next morning before taking a car back to the village.
……
Day two.
The roof tiles were delivered to the end of the village early in the morning.
After breakfast, Chen Youjin led the three young men to the dilapidated house that Zhao Yan was renting.
The two looked honest and unassuming, not like talkative people.
The other one Zhao Yan met yesterday was Chen Youjin's eldest son, Chen Hu.
Zhao Yan didn't think anything of it.
As long as you do your job well, she won't say much.
"Uncle Muramasa, thank you for your hard work."
Seeing that Zhao Yan didn't say anything, Chen Youjin waved his hand with satisfaction, "It's alright."
He urged the three stunned men, "Let's get to work."
The house is a brick and tile house, and the roofs of the three main rooms are somewhat leaky and need to be repaired.
The west wing is fine; it can be moved into after a little tidying up.
The kitchen on the east side suffered the most severe roof damage and took the longest to repair because it was used for cooking every day.
The main gate also needs to be rebuilt.
By the time everything was finished, it was already getting late.
